  • Publication number: 20250109517
    Abstract: Disclosed is a method for leaching lithium via an electrochemical apparatus including a multi-functional current collector, an electrode, an electrolyte, and a lithium-bearing material, wherein the lithium-bearing material is dispersed or suspended in the electrolyte or the lithium-bearing material is coated onto the current collector. The method involves applying voltage to the current collector to leach lithium from the lithium-bearing material. The method can involve adding promoter additive into the electrolyte to boost lithium extraction within the electrochemical apparatus.

  • Patent number: 11244237
    Abstract: Implementations for determining deployment need for a point of interest (POI) are disclosed. In one implementation, the deployment need for a POI is determined by: receiving geographical locations of one or more users, determining, based on the geographical locations, one or more target users covered by an area to be inspected, determining one or more POI deployment need indexes of the one or more target users, a POI deployment need index of a target user being determined based on a number of POIs that have the preset function of the POI and were deployed within a set distance from the target user, and providing a total deployment need index for the area to be inspected, the total deployment need index being determined based on the one or more POI deployment need indexes.
